Victory and Overcoming! God has seated us in the position of VICTORY and made us more than overcomers through HIs finished work. Come build your faith for YOUR VICTORY in CHRIST today. Key ideas: We confess the Word because it is true, we are not trying to 'make it true.' The truth is eternal and holds all authority. Facts are temporary and subject to change. Good core verses for faith and confession: There is nothing impossible for me with God. I can do all things through Christ who Strengthens me. No weapon formed against me will prosper. Isaiah 54:17 Whether it is the stones against Steven, or the words against your mind, no weapon against us is the final word. Negative thoughts are defeated by SPEAKING the truth, and death and separation from God and His family is defeated. We live WITH GOD and GOD'S people for eternity. That is the fruit of the finished work of Jesus. To build faith, we hear the Word of faith, confess our faith (speak) and stir up our faith with prayer. In addition to faith, we add: KnowledgeGod's Vision for our life. Daily action Every day, you are who GOD has made you to be. Speak, think, and act that way.
